Marc Topkin / Tampa Bay Times:
Confirmed news on Rays' Alex Cobb: Partial tear in elbow, will try to pitch through it  —  Rays RHP Alex Cobb's season is very much in jeopardy.  —  The Tampa Bay Times has learned and confirmed that a new more detailed MRI revealed a partial tear in his elbow ligament.

Zach Braziller / New York Post:
Alderson guesses, but murky on Wright's return  —  David Wright's return remains uncertain.  The Captain, out since April 15 with a hamstring injury, is at the team's minor-league complex in Port St. Lucie, Fla., working to get back, but he's still not at 100 percent, general manager Sandy Alderson told The Post.

Jeff Todd / MLB Trade Rumors:
Rangers Claim Mike Kickham  —  The Rangers have claimed lefty Mike Kickham off waivers from the Mariners, club executive VP of communications John Blake announced.  Outfielder Ryan Rua was transferred to the 60-day DL to create space.  —  Per the release, Kickham will be optioned to Triple-A to start his tenure with Texas.

Associated Press:
Brewers Win in Counsell's Debut, 4-3 Over Dodgers  —  MILWAUKEE — The Milwaukee Brewers rallied for three runs in the eighth inning to win in Craig Counsell's managerial debut, a 4-3 victory over the Los Angeles Dodgers on Monday night.  —  Dodgers starter Clayton Kershaw was denied his 100th career win, and took a no-decision.

Associated Press:
Martin Gets Tiebreaking Hit, Blue Jays Beat Yankees 3-1  —  TORONTO — Pinch-hitter Russell Martin singled home the go-ahead run in the eighth inning and the Toronto Blue Jays beat the Yankees 3-1 on Monday night, snapping New York's road winning streak at six games.
